Aluminum extrusion dies

As you know, we specialize in the production of tools for mechanical processing. Today, however, we’re talking about dies for aluminum extrusion. What’s the connection? Let’s start with the basics: what is a die and what is it used for?

A die is essential for any operation that involves the extrusion of a material. It allows for plastic deformation to create parts with a constant cross-section. Extrusion basically consists of forcing a pasty material through a die that replicates the external shape of the part you want to create, using compression.

Tools for Making Mandrels

  • 144/144 L: A cylindrical tool with 4 cutting edges and a relieved collar at various lengths. It’s suitable for machining the feeds and, thanks to its special geometry, it’s also perfect for working on very deep central feeds, reducing vibrations caused by radii equal to the tool’s radius.
  • 141/142/155: Milling cutters suitable for finishing the profile after heat treatment. They guarantee long durability and perpendicularity, and are also suitable for machining smaller profiles.
  • 149/159A/726: These are mainly suitable for machining the channels under the core in 5-axis copying, both continuous and indexed. This ensures very tight machining tolerances for maximum efficiency and tool life.

Tools for Making Dies

  • Tapered tools: These are new-generation tools that guarantee top-level performance that remains consistent over time, even for difficult and long-lasting jobs.
  • 113EV: A cylindrical tool with 4 cutting edges suitable for machining welding chambers and pre-zones, both with full and stepped passes. It’s a single tool that can be used both before and after heat treatment.
